Borrowing a Loan Online: What You Need to Know
Before we dive into the nitty-gritty of online lending, let’s cover some basics. Here are some essential points to consider when borrowing a loan online:
- Interest rates: Understand the interest rates charged by the lender and how they affect your loan amount.
- Repayment terms: Know the repayment schedule and any penalties for late payments.
- Credit score: Understand how your credit score affects your loan eligibility and interest rates.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is online loan borrowing, and how does it work?
Online loan borrowing is the process of applying for a loan through digital platforms, bypassing traditional banking routes. This process typically involves filling out an application form, providing personal and financial information, and waiting for approval from the lender.
What are the benefits of borrowing a loan online?
The benefits of borrowing a loan online include convenience, speed, and flexibility. Online loan platforms often offer 24/7 accessibility, allowing borrowers to apply for loans at their own pace. Additionally, online lenders may offer more competitive interest rates and terms compared to traditional lenders.
What are the risks associated with borrowing a loan online?
The risks associated with borrowing a loan online include scams, high-interest rates, and predatory lending practices. Borrowers should be cautious when selecting a lender and ensure they understand the terms and conditions of the loan before committing.
How do I choose the right online loan lender?
To choose the right online loan lender, research and compare different lenders, checking their reputation, interest rates, and customer reviews. Look for lenders that are registered and regulated by relevant authorities, and ensure they have a clear and transparent loan application process.
What documents do I need to provide to borrow a loan online?
The documents required to borrow a loan online may vary depending on the lender, but typically include identification documents (e.g., passport, ID card), proof of income, and proof of address. Borrowers should check with the lender for specific requirements before applying.

Quick Tips for a Smooth Loan Experience
• Always research the lender thoroughly before applying for a loan.
• Carefully review the terms and conditions before accepting a loan offer.
• Make timely payments to avoid late fees and penalties.
• Consider using a loan calculator to estimate your repayments.
